There is a popular Chinese saying “to get rich, first build a road.” The Chinese proverb had it right – without infrastructure, economic development cannot happen. Infrastructure1 is a heterogeneous term, comprising of physical structures of several kinds employed by numerous industries as inputs to the production of goods and services. This description includes “economic infrastructure” (such as network utilities) and “social infrastructure” (such as hospitals and schools).
